The Odisha government has transferred 41 IAS officers, including 17 district collectors. The move comes ahead of the Lok Sabha polls and assembly elections in the state
he Odisha government made a reshuffle in its bureaucracy by transferring 41 IAS officers, according to a notification.
Among those transferred were 17 district collectors, as per the notification issued by the General Administration & Pension and Grievances Department on Monday.
The reshuffle was made with an eye on the Lok Sabha polls and assembly elections, which are usually held simultaneously in the state, officials said.
